Question: I am a girl who would like to serve the revolution by entering the Revolutionary Guards Corps, but my father does not approve. Please could you tell me what my position is according to the shari’a law?
Reply: The sisters may become revolutionary guards so long as Islamic precepts are observed. You had better seek your father’s consent.
Istifta’at Vol. 1, p. 503.

Question: Are wrestling and boxing allowed?
Answer: It is permissible to engage in wrestling and boxing without betting as long as it does not lead to serious bodily harm.

The word "Ghadir" is of several meanings in terminology, such as "pond", "a piece of water," and "rain water".
Ghadir Khom is located in the middle of the two great cities of the Muslim world, Mecca and Medina, in the place called "Ja'fah"; and at the time of the messenger of Islam (peace be upon him and his progeny), the Hajj caravans separated there and went toward their own country. The lexical root of 'tasawwuf' is variously traced to sūf "wool", referring to the simple wool-made cloaks the early Muslim ascetics wore and who claimed to purify their inner self from filth and stay away from worldly attractions, thus engaging in so-called spiritual self-reconstruction.
